在这个信息爆炸的时代,数据已经成为了一种宝贵的资源。网站数据接口作为一种获取大量数据的途径,对于研究人员、数据分析师以及企业来说都具有重要的价值。那么,如何轻松识别和利用网站数据接口,助力高效数据采集呢?接下来,我将带你一步步走进这个神秘的领域。
一、什么是网站数据接口?
网站数据接口,又称API(应用程序编程接口),是网站或应用程序提供的一种用于数据交互的接口。通过调用这些接口,开发者可以获取到网站或应用程序中的数据,实现数据的采集和分析。
二、如何识别网站数据接口?
观察网站结构:首先,我们需要观察目标网站的URL结构,从中寻找可能的接口。例如,有些网站会在URL中包含版本号、方法名等信息,这些都是识别接口的线索。
搜索关键字:在搜索引擎中输入目标网站名称加上“API”、“接口”、“数据”等关键字,查找相关资料。
分析网页源代码:通过查看网页源代码,寻找可能的接口调用代码,如JavaScript中的AJAX请求等。
参考第三方平台:有些第三方平台会收集和整理网站接口信息,如开发者社区、API目录等。
三、如何利用网站数据接口?
使用编程语言进行调用:常见的编程语言如Python、Java、JavaScript等,都提供了丰富的库和工具,可以方便地调用API接口。
使用第三方API接口工具:市面上有许多第三方API接口工具,如Postman、Fiddler等,可以帮助开发者测试和调用API接口。
编写爬虫程序:对于一些没有公开API接口的网站,我们可以通过编写爬虫程序来获取数据。常用的爬虫框架有Scrapy、BeautifulSoup等。
四、高效数据采集技巧
合理设置请求频率:在调用API接口时,要注意控制请求频率,避免给目标网站造成过大压力。
处理异常情况:在数据采集过程中,可能会遇到各种异常情况,如网络问题、接口限制等。要提前做好预案,确保数据采集的稳定性。
数据清洗和整理:采集到的数据往往需要进行清洗和整理,去除无效数据、重复数据等。
利用数据分析工具:对于采集到的数据,可以使用数据分析工具进行进一步的分析和处理,挖掘数据价值。
五、结语
掌握网站数据接口的识别和利用技巧,可以帮助我们高效地获取数据,为各种应用场景提供数据支持。在享受数据红利的同时,我们也要遵守相关法律法规,尊重网站和用户的隐私权益。希望本文能对你有所帮助,祝你数据采集之旅顺利!
